Tools for tracking delivery

Tools for tracking delivery

When it comes to tracking delivery, there are several tools that can make a world of difference. For instance, I’ve often relied on mobile apps that provide real-time GPS tracking. The moment I see that little icon moving closer to my house, it’s an instant boost to my mood. Have you ever noticed how knowing your food is just around the corner can turn anticipation into excitement?

There are also browser extensions and websites that aggregate delivery status from multiple providers. I remember using one for a particularly busy night when I had dinner plans with friends. I could simultaneously track multiple orders, which eased my mind. These tools let you consolidate updates in one place, making it effortless to stay in the loop.

Lastly, some delivery services offer SMS notifications or email updates. I appreciate a simple text letting me know my order is on its way, especially when I’m in the middle of cooking for a crowd. It’s thoughtful touches like these that enhance the overall experience, making meals feel special. Common issues and solutions

Common issues and solutions

One common issue I’ve faced with delivery tracking is a lack of updates. There are times when my order seems to disappear from the tracking map, leaving me feeling anxious and wondering if it got lost. To counter this, I’ve learned to always keep contact information handy. When things seem stuck, reaching out to customer service has often led to clear answers and a more peace-of-mind experience.

Another challenge I’ve encountered is the inaccuracy of estimated delivery times. It can be frustrating when I plan my evening around the promised timeframe, only to have it stretch out longer than expected. I’ve found that checking for local traffic updates before placing my order helps me anticipate delays better. After all, who wants to be left hungry and waiting longer than necessary?

Lastly, there’s the issue of receiving someone else’s order, which has happened to me more than once! It can be amusing but also infuriating. I’ve learned that contacting the restaurant directly and providing details of my situation can often lead to a quick resolution. Sharing my experience on social media has also helped create awareness, prompting the company to address these mishaps more seriously.
